Q: What is the purpose of using a buffer solution in electrophoresis?
Solution: Buffer solutions maintain a stable pH, which is crucial for the proper separation of charged molecules during electrophoresis.
Steps: 5
Step 1: Understand that electrophoresis is a technique used to separate charged molecules, like DNA or proteins, based on their size and charge.
Step 2: Know that the separation process happens in a gel or liquid medium where an electric current is applied.
Step 3: Realize that the pH level of the medium can affect how the charged molecules behave during separation.
Step 4: Learn that a buffer solution is a special type of solution that helps keep the pH level stable.
Step 5: Understand that by maintaining a stable pH, the buffer solution ensures that the charged molecules move correctly and separate properly during electrophoresis.
